




已阅读5页,还剩8页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第3章 信息在计算机中的编码与表示 计算机应用的实质就是使用计算机进行信息处理。信息的 表现形式包括:数值形式 非数值形式 信息 文字 声音 图像 视频 由于计算机只能识别1和0,因此在计算机内表示的数字、文 字、声音、图像和视频等信息都要以二进制数码的组合来代表 ,这就是二进制编码。 根据不同的用途,有各种各样的编码方案,较常用的有BCD 码(用二进制表示十进制数的编码方式)、 ASCII码(西文信 息的编码方式)、汉字编码(中文信息的编码)等。 信息在计算机中的表示 数值数值 十二进制转换十二进制转换 西文西文 ASCII ASCII码码 汉字汉字 输入码机内码转换输入码机内码转换 声音、图像声音、图像 模数转换模数转换 二十进制转换二十进制转换 西文字形码西文字形码 汉字字形码汉字字形码 数模转换数模转换 内存内存 输入输入设备设备 输出设备输出设备 数值数值 西文西文 汉字汉字 声音、图像声音、图像 信息在计算机中的编码与表示 BCD码 由于人们日常使用的是十进制十进制,而机器内使用的是二进制二进制,所 以,需要将十进制表示成二进制码。其中,BCD (Binary Coded Decimal)比较常用。 BCD码有多种编码方式,常用的是8421有权码。它将十进制数 码09中的每个数分别用4位二进制编码表示,即用: 00000000,00010001,00100010,00110011, ,01000100, 01010101,01100110,01110111,10001000,10011001, 分别表示09的十进制数码。由于从左至右每一位对应的权分 别是8、4、2、1。因此取名为8421码。 BCD码十分直观,可以很容易实现与十进制的转换。例如: (0010 1000 0101 1001 . 0111 0100)(0010 1000 0101 1001 . 0111 0100)BCD BCD = 2859.74 = 2859.74 BCD码有两种形式,即压缩BCD码和非压缩BCD码: 压缩BCD码的每一位用4位二进制数表示,一个字节能表示 两位十进制数。 非压缩BCD码用1个字节表示一位十进制数,高4为总是 0000。 信息在计算机中的编码与表示 字符、字符集及其码表 字符(character):文字的基本元素,包括:字母、数字、 标点、符号等。 字符集:一组特定字符的集合,如西文字符集、中文字符 集、日文字符集等。 字符的编码: 字符集中每个字符都使用二进位表示,称为该字符的 编码 不同的字符其编码各不相同 字符集中所有字符的编码的一览表,称为该字符集的 码表 信息在计算机中的编码与表示 ASCII码 西文是表音文字(拼音文字),它由拉丁字母、数字、标点符号 以及一些特殊符号所组成。 美国标准信息交换码(American Standard Code for Information Interchange, 简称ASCII码): ASCII字符集包含95个可打印字符和33个控制字符 采用7个二进位进行编码,即能表示128个字符 计算机中使用1个字节存储1个ASCII 字符,其中最高位取0 存在问题: 7位代码空间太小(只能对128个字符编码) 不同国家和地区使用不同的字符集及其编码,互不兼容 东亚地区使用的大字符集无法编码 信息在计算机中的编码与表示 标准ASCII字符集及其码表 b6 b5 b4 b3 b2 b1 b0 0 1 2 3 4 5 6 7 0 1 2 3 4 5 6 7 8 9 A B C D E F b6b5b4 b3b2b1b0 0 1 1 01 0 01 1 0 1 0 1 1 注:大小写英文字母的ASCII编码只有1位不同,其他位都相同 汉字是记录汉语(国语,华语)的文字,属于表意文字,它用 符号直接表达词或词素,比西文复杂。 为了解决计算机上的汉字输入、存储、处理、传输和输出问题 ,汉字编码根据环节的不同,主要有: 输入码:主要用于解决在计算机上输入汉字的问题 文本准备 - 数字编码,字音编码,字形编码,形音编码 机内码:主要用于解决在计算机内的存储、处理和传输 GB2312、GBK、GB18030编码标准 字形码:主要用于解决汉字输出的问题 文本展现 信息在计算机中的编码与表示 汉字码 驾驶员之家 /ks/ 2016年新题库科目一模拟考试 驾驶员之家 /aqks/ 2016年安全文明驾驶常识模拟 考试 驾驶员之家 /chexing/c1.html C1驾驶证能开什么车 驾驶员之家 /chexing/c2.html C2驾驶证能开什么车 驾驶员之家 /chexing/c3.html C3驾驶证能开什么车 驾驶员之家 /chexing/c4.html C4驾驶证能开什么车 驾驶员之家 /chexing/a1.html A1驾驶证能开什么车 驾驶员之家 /chexing/a2.html A2驾驶证能开什么车 驾驶员之家 /chexing/a3.html A3驾驶证能开什么车 驾驶员之家 /chexing/b1.html B1驾驶证能开什么车 驾驶员之家 /chexing/b2.html B2驾驶证能开什么车 类型 原理举例优点缺点 数字 编码 使用一串数字来表示 汉字 电报码 区位码 仅使用10个数 字键 难记忆 字音 编码 把汉语的拼音作为 汉字的输入编码 智能ABC 紫光 微软拼音输入 简单易学,适 合于非专业人 员 重码多,需增加选择 操作,不会汉语拼音 或不知道读音时无法 使用 字形 编码 把汉字的部件或笔画 作为码元,按照汉 字结构及其切分规 则作为编码 依据, 确定每个汉字的输入 代码 五笔字形 表形码 郑码 重码少、输入 速度较快,适 合于专业录 入员、打字员 使用 缺乏统一的规范,编 码规则 不易掌握 音形 编码 (或形音 编码) 采用字音及字形两种 属性作为码元的汉 字编码输 入方法 粤音输入法同上同时要掌握音、形两 种取码方法或规则, 对普通用户比较困难 信息在计算机中的编码与表示 汉字输入码的比较分析 信息在计算机中的编码与表示 汉字机内码的比较分析 标 准 名 称 国家标准 GB2312 汉字扩充规 范 GBK 国家标准 GB18030 UCS-2 (Unicode) 字 符 集 6763个 汉字(简 体字) 21003个汉 字(包括 GB2312汉 字在内) 27 000多 汉字(包括 GBK汉字 和CJK及 其扩充中 的汉字) 包含10万字符 ,其中的汉字 与GB18030相 同 编 码 方 法 双字节存 储和表示 ,每个字 节的最高 位均为 “1” 双字节存储 和表示,第 1个字节的 最高位必为 “1” 部分双字 节、部分 4字节表 示 (1) UTF-8 单字节可变长 编码 (2) UTF-16 双字节可变长 编码 兼 容 性 编码 不兼容! GBK 00 FF 00 FF 20902 汉字 00 FF 00 FF 6763 汉字 GB2312 00 FF 00 FF 27484 汉字 GB18030 编码保持向下兼容 注:三个编码标准中都存在的汉字,它们在计算机中的机内码 都是相同的。 汉字机内码的每个字节 都大于128,以避免与 ASCII码冲突 字形码就是描述汉字字形信息的编码字形码就是描述汉字字形信息的编码,它主要分为两大类: 字模编码和矢量编码。 字模编码字模编码是将汉字字形点阵进行编码,其方法是将汉字 写在一个2424的坐标纸上,在每个格子中就出现有墨 和无墨两种情况,计算机就让每一个格子占一个二进制 位,并规定有墨的地方用“1”表示,无墨的地方用“0”,然 后将这些1、0按顺序排列下来,就成为汉字字模码。 显然,点阵的点越多时,表示(显示或打印)质量就也 越高,也就越美观,但同时占用的容量也越大。点阵汉 字表示简单,但在放大、缩小、变形后不够美观。 矢量汉字编码法矢量汉字编码法。矢量汉字就是将汉字的形状、笔划、字根 等用数学函数进行描述的方法。如TrueType就是一种,这 样的字形信息便于缩放和变换,并且字形美观。 信息在计算机中
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025江苏宿迁市泗洪县卫健系统面向社会招聘工作人员5人考前自测高频考点模拟试题及答案详解(易错题)
- 2025珠海成人高考真题及答案
- 学校三年发展规划(2025.1-2027.12):聚焦核心克难题全力以赴谱新篇
- 2025年药物治疗学用药方案设计与用药安全策略测试答案及解析
- 2025甘肃省地矿局测绘院注册城乡规划师预招聘3人考前自测高频考点模拟试题(含答案详解)
- 2025成人高考政治真题及答案
- 2025年血液科学科白血病靶向治疗药物应用考核模拟试卷答案及解析
- 2025年心血管病学心肌梗死诊疗标准验证答案及解析
- 2025年流行病学流行病学调查评估模拟试卷答案及解析
- 2025年血液学科血液病诊断与治疗策略考查答案及解析
- 5.1延续文化血脉 教案 -2025-2026学年统编版道德与法治九年级上册
- 2025年保密观原题附答案
- 基于项目学习的英语核心素养心得体会
- 2025年全球汽车供应链核心企业竞争力白皮书-罗兰贝格
- 第六章-材料的热性能
- (完整版)抛丸机安全操作规程
- 高一前三章数学试卷
- 自助与成长:大学生心理健康教育
- 2025年新高考2卷(新课标Ⅱ卷)语文试卷
- 货款对抵协议书
- 2025至2030中国特殊教育市场现状调查及前景方向研究报告
评论
0/150
提交评论